Midland city council authorizes creation of The Preserve Municipal Management District

The Midland City Council unanimously approved a resolution on Feb. 25 to establish The Preserve Municipal Management District (MMD), a financial mechanism designed to support the development of The Preserve. This large-scale mixed-use project, set to break ground in early 2025 on the former Nueva Vista Golf Club site, will feature retail, office spaces, dining, and a new zoo. Nearly half of the development will be dedicated to parks, open areas, and natural recreational spaces.

Diamondback Energy Kaes Van’t Hof to succeed Travis Stice as CEO

Diamondback Energy announced a leadership transition plan that will see President Kaes Van’t Hof assume the role of Chief Executive Officer, succeeding longtime CEO Travis D. Stice at the company’s 2025 Annual Meeting of Stockholders. Stice, who has led Diamondback since 2012, will remain with the company as Executive Chairman through the 2026 Annual Meeting.
